ModelScope实战指南:快速掌握AI模型即服务的核心技巧
ModelScope是一个基于"模型即服务"理念的开源平台,致力于将最先进的AI模型整合并提供统一的调用接口。作为Python开发者的AI工具箱,它能让你轻松调用700+个预训练模型,涵盖计算机视觉、自然语言处理、语音识别等多个领域。
核心概念:理解ModelScope的工作机制
你会发现ModelScope的核心设计非常巧妙。它通过统一的pipeline接口封装了不同领域模型的调用细节,让你只需关注业务逻辑而非技术实现。这种抽象层设计让AI应用开发变得异常简单。
提示:ModelScope支持PyTorch、TensorFlow和ONNX等多种深度学习框架,为开发者提供了极大的灵活性。
实战技巧:三步上手AI模型调用
环境配置的捷径
创建独立的Python环境是避免依赖冲突的最佳实践。使用conda快速搭建开发环境:
conda create -n modelscope python=3.8
conda activate modelscope
pip install modelscope
你会发现安装过程非常顺畅,大部分模型都能在Windows、Mac和Linux系统上正常运行。
模型调用的快速入门
从简单的文本处理开始,你会惊讶于ModelScope的强大:
from modelscope.pipelines import pipeline
word_segmentation = pipeline('word-segmentation')
result = word_segmentation('今天天气不错,适合出去游玩')
这种简洁的API设计让你在几分钟内就能完成第一个AI应用的开发。
实用场景案例展示
在实际项目中,你可以利用ModelScope快速实现:
- 人像抠图与背景替换
- 智能语音识别与合成
- 多模态内容理解
- 科学计算与数据分析
进阶应用:打造专业级AI解决方案
当你熟悉基础操作后,可以探索更高级的功能:
模型微调:基于预训练模型进行领域适配 分布式训练:支持大规模模型的并行训练 部署优化:提供模型导出和部署支持
通过ModelScope的模块化设计,你可以灵活定制每个处理环节,构建符合特定业务需求的AI应用。
快速上手建议:
- 从官方示例开始,逐步理解API调用逻辑
- 选择熟悉的领域模型进行实验
- 参考社区案例,学习最佳实践
ModelScope不仅降低了AI应用开发的门槛,更为开发者提供了从实验到生产的完整工具链。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考




